The radiofrequency (RF) ablation single electrode market size has demonstrated significant expansion in recent years. This market is set to expand from $1.08 billion in 2025 to $1.19 billion in 2026, progressing at a compound annual growth rate (CAGR) of 9.5%. Historically, the market’s growth can be linked to the rising occurrence of cardiac arrhythmias demanding ablation therapies, the initial adoption of open surgical ablation methods, restricted access to minimally invasive RF systems, advancements in catheter-based electrode designs, and the enhancement of hospital interventional cardiology infrastructure.

The radiofrequency (RF) ablation single electrode market is anticipated to experience substantial growth over the coming years. By 2030, its valuation is projected to reach $1.72 billion, exhibiting a compound annual growth rate (CAGR) of 9.8%. This expansion during the forecast period is primarily driven by an increasing move towards outpatient minimally invasive procedures, continuous advancements in precision energy delivery systems, a heightened demand for safer temperature-controlled ablation technologies, a surge in procedural volumes within emerging healthcare markets, and ongoing innovation in electrode miniaturization and usability. Key trends anticipated during this period encompass the rising adoption of high-precision single electrode RF ablation for precise tissue destruction, a broadening preference for minimally invasive ablation methods over traditional open surgical interventions, the increased utilization of internally cooled and temperature-controlled electrode systems aimed at minimizing collateral thermal damage, the proliferation of disposable single-use RF ablation electrodes to enhance infection control and overall procedural safety, and the incorporation of real-time imaging-guided navigation into RF ablation procedures for elevated accuracy.

Radiofrequency (RF) Ablation Single Electrode Market Expansion Drivers: What Is Shaping Future Growth?

The growing inclination towards non-invasive cosmetic procedures is projected to advance the radiofrequency (RF) ablation single electrode market in the future. Non-invasive cosmetic procedures are defined as aesthetic treatments designed to enhance appearance without surgery, utilizing external or minimally invasive methods that do not involve body incision or extensive recovery. The increasing preference for these procedures is attributed to greater awareness of available aesthetic enhancement options, alongside a strong desire for safer treatments that offer minimal downtime, fewer associated risks, and quicker visible results. Radiofrequency (RF) ablation single electrode technology enables precise thermal energy delivery to targeted tissue, stimulating collagen remodeling for minimally invasive cosmetic applications such as skin tightening and rejuvenation with minimal recovery time. For instance, in June 2024, data from the American Society of Plastic Surgeons, a US-based non-profit organization, indicated that liposuction procedures reached a total of 347,782 in 2023, marking a 7% increase compared to 2022. During the same period, minimally invasive procedures also expanded by 7%, exceeding the growth of surgical procedures by 2 percentage points. Therefore, the increasing preference for non-invasive cosmetic procedures is significantly driving the growth of the radiofrequency (RF) ablation single electrode market.

Radiofrequency (RF) Ablation Single Electrode Market Regional Distribution: Which Areas Drive Market Expansion?

North America was the largest region in the radiofrequency (RF) ablation single electrode market in 2025. Asia-Pacific is expected to be the fastest-growing region in the forecast period. The regions covered in the radiofrequency (RF) ablation single electrode market report are Asia-Pacific, South East Asia, Western Europe, Eastern Europe, North America, South America, Middle East, Africa.
